Abstract

The utility model belongs to the technical field of surveying instrument, and discloses a surveying instrument positioning device for engineering surveying and mapping, which comprises a bracket, wherein the bottom of the bracket is in an annular array and is rotatably connected with three supporting rods, three are arranged in the accommodating cavities, three are arranged with connecting rods, three are arranged at the bottoms of the connecting rods, three are arranged with adjusting bolts, the outer walls of the supporting rods are rotatably connected with adjusting bolts, a base plate is arranged at the top of the bracket, the top of the base plate is rotatably connected with a surveying instrument main body, the utility model discloses a push the convex rods and the connecting rods to retract the convex rods and the connecting rods into the accommodating cavities, and the convex rods and the connecting rods are fixed by screwing the adjusting bolts, and are shielded by the supporting rods, when a user transfers the device, the convex rods are not easy to cause injury to the user, thereby achieving the effect of improving the safety guarantee of the user.

Background
Surveying instruments, which are simply instruments and devices for data acquisition, processing, output and the like designed and manufactured for surveying and mapping operation, are used for various aspects of orientation, distance measurement, angle measurement, height measurement, mapping, photogrammetry and the like required by measurement work in the planning, design, construction and operation management stages in engineering construction.
But the device on the existing market does not set up the structure of accomodating the nose bar, because the nose bar bottom is comparatively sharp-pointed, when user transfer device, the nose bar causes the injury to the user easily, reduces user's safety guarantee, and surveying instrument main part and support be difficult for dismantling, when user needs separation surveying instrument main part and support, need unscrew a large amount of fixed knot and construct, greatly increased the dismantlement degree of difficulty between surveying instrument main part and the support, reduced the dismantlement efficiency of surveying instrument main part and support.

Referring to fig. 1-4, the present invention provides the following technical solutions: the utility model provides an engineering is mapping appearance positioner for survey and drawing, which comprises a bracket 4, 4 bottoms of support are the annular array and rotate and be connected with three bracing piece 8, accomodate chamber 11 has all been seted up to the inside of three bracing piece 8, connecting rod 10 is all installed to the inside of three chamber 11 of accomodating, nose bar 1 is all installed to the bottom of three connecting rod 10, the outer wall of three bracing piece 8 all closes soon and is connected with adjusting bolt 9, base plate 7 is installed at the top of support 4, the top of base plate 7 is rotated and is connected with surveying instrument main part 6, through promoting nose bar 1 and connecting rod 10, make nose bar 1 and connecting rod 10 retract accomodate in the chamber 11, tighten adjusting bolt 9, thereby fixed nose bar 1 and connecting rod 10, shelter from nose bar 1 and connecting rod 10 through bracing piece 8, thereby avoid 1 injury user of.
Further, two mounting brackets 16 are installed to 4 circumferencial planes of support symmetry, two mounting brackets 16 all run through with support 4 and have the carriage release lever 14, one side fixedly connected with movable plate 12 that the carriage release lever 14 periphery is close to mounting bracket 16, and one side cover that carriage release lever 14 is close to movable plate 12 is equipped with spring 13, two jacks 15 have been seted up to the symmetry that base plate 7 is close to 14 one side of carriage release lever, promote movable plate 12 through the inside spring 13 of mounting bracket 16, drive the carriage release lever 14 through movable plate 12 and remove, make carriage release lever 14 insert to between 7 inside jack 15 of base plate and support 4, when surveying instrument main part 6 and base plate 7 need be dismantled, only need spur carriage release lever 14, can dismantle surveying instrument main part 6 and base plate 7.
Further, pole 5 is installed at the top of surveying instrument main part 6, and the cover is equipped with the handle cover on the pole 5, lets surveying instrument main part 6 be convenient for take through handle cover and pole 5.
Further, finger 2 is all installed to adjusting bolt 9's both sides, and the finger groove has all been seted up to finger 2's both sides, lets adjusting bolt 9 be convenient for rotate through finger 2 and finger groove.
Furthermore, the pull ring 3 is installed at the one end of the movable rod 14 extending to the outside of the mounting frame 16, a pull hole is formed in the pull ring 3, and the movable rod 14 is convenient to pull through the pull hole and the pull ring 3.
Furthermore, the longitudinal sections of the moving rod 14 and the insertion hole 15 are circular structures, and the diameter of the moving rod 14 is smaller than that of the insertion hole 15, so that the moving rod 14 can be inserted conveniently through the insertion hole 15 with a larger diameter.
The utility model discloses a theory of operation and use flow: when the utility model is used, the device is moved to a use point, the three support rods 8 are rotated to expand the support rods 8, the support 4 is supported by the convex rods 1, the connecting rods 10 and the support rods 8, the surveying instrument main body 6 is taken by the rod 5, the surveying instrument main body 6 is placed on the support 4 through the base plate 7, the movable plate 12 is extruded and pushed by the spring 13, the movable plate 12 drives the movable rod 14 to move, the movable rod 14 is inserted between the jack 15 inside the base plate 7 and the support 4, so that the base plate 7 and the surveying instrument main body 6 are fixed, when the surveying instrument main body 6 needs to be disassembled, only the movable rod 14 needs to be pulled to drive the movable plate 12 to move, the movable rod 14 is separated from the jack 15, the base plate 7 and the surveying instrument main body 6 can be disassembled, when the device needs to be carried to move, the adjusting bolt 9 is unscrewed, the convex rods 1 and the connecting rods 10 are pushed into the, screw up adjusting bolt 9, can be fixed in storage cavity 11 with nose bar 1 and connecting rod 10, block nose bar 1 and connecting rod 10 through bracing piece 8 to avoid 1 injury users of nose bar.
